Call For Papers

The 2nd International Symposium on u- and e- Service, Science and Technology will be held on October 12~14, 2009, Melbourne, Australia.

UNESST 2009 will be the most comprehensive Symposium focused on the various aspects of advances in u- and e- Service, Science and Technology. Our Symposium provides a chance for academic and industry professionals to discuss recent progress in the area of u- and e- Service, Science and Technology.

The goal of this Symposium is to bring together the researchers from academia and industry as well as practitioners to share ideas, problems and solutions relating to the multifaceted aspects of u- and e- Service, Science and Technology.

All accepted and registered papers will be included in the conference proceeding published by IEEE CS (as a Short Paper, 4 pages. Indexed by EI). And most presented papers at the conference, after revision and extension, will be included in CCIS (as a Full Paper, at least 12 pages. New LNCS sister-series, indexed by EI). And some papers selected will be included in some journals (pending).
